Liquor Licensing
In accordance with current liquor laws in BC, alcohol served at a private event must be purchased by either the host or the venue. However, with a Special Events Permit (SEP), the event host can purchase alcohol for Jean & Tonic to dispense at the event. The host may also be required to complete their SIR (Serving it right) online (Serving It Right Course | Responsible Service BC (gov.bc.ca) - quick and easy process and we are happy to help guide you.

Power Requirements
Jean & Tonic requires a standard 120V outlet to operate just about anywhere, both indoors & outdoors. Our mobile bar cart also comes equipped with a generator if required (additional fee may be applicable).
